Copyright Clearance Center was founded in 1978. It operates as a specialized licensing organization rather than a traditional forex broker. This comprehensive ccc review reveals that CCC functions as an intermediary between rightsholders and institutions, facilitating copyright licensing agreements primarily for academic publishers. The organization maintains a not-for-profit status. It has established itself as a significant player in the intellectual property licensing sector.
CCC's business model centers on procuring agreements with rightsholders. The company acts as their agent in arranging collective licensing for institutions, document delivery services, and coursepacks. CCC demonstrates financial transparency by passing more than 70% of its revenues to publishers as royalty payments. The company retains approximately 30% as service fees. Copyright Clearance Center represents a unique entity in the business services sector. The organization has operated since 1978 as a not-for-profit organization. Founded in response to negotiations preceding the United States Copyright Act of 1976, CCC has developed into a comprehensive licensing intermediary serving academic institutions, libraries, and content users worldwide. The organization's primary mission involves facilitating legal access to copyrighted materials through structured licensing agreements.
CCC's business model revolves around establishing relationships with rightsholders, particularly academic publishers. The company subsequently manages licensing arrangements for various institutional needs. CCC handles collective licensing for institutions, one-time licensing for document delivery services, and specialized licensing for educational coursepacks.
